Pilonidal Sinus

A pilonidal sinus (PNS) is a small hole or tunnel in the skin. It may fill with fluid or pus, causing the formation of a cyst or abscess. It occurs in the cleft at the top of the buttocks. A pilonidal cyst usually contains hair, dirt, and debris. It can cause severe pain and can often become infected. If it becomes infected, it may ooze pus and blood and have a foul odor.

A PNS is a condition that mostly affects men and is also common in young adults. It’s also more common in people who sit a lot, like cab drivers, truck drivers etc

The exact cause of this condition isn’t known, but its cause is believed to be a combination of changing hormones (because it occurs after puberty), hair growth, and friction from clothes or from spending a long time sitting.

The signs of an infection include:

  • Pain when sitting or standing
  • Swelling at the natal cleft ( low back region between buttocks)
  • Reddened, sore skin around the area
  • Pus or blood draining from the abscess, causing a foul odor
  • A low-grade fever, but this is much less common

Surgical treatment is the mainstay for permanent cure of the disease, medical treatment in the form of broad-spectrum antibiotics and analgesics may be needed in the acute phase to control infection and relieve pain. Once the infection is controlled surgery should be performed for a complete cure. Different surgical procedures have been described but the principle of surgery remains wide and complete excision of the sinus and its tracts
